I like him. Watched him a few times this past season during UNR’s hot start and closely against USC at Galen. Imposes his will with his wide/muscular frame when he takes it to the basket, draws plenty of fouls & gets to the line at a petty high rate. That said, he gets low to the ground when attacking the basket. Despite having over 200 FT attempts, he only shot 63% but still averaged 17 points + 9.6 rebounds/game. Holds the record for most double double’s in Mountain West History with 44 which is 4 ahead of the previous record holders, Kawhi Leonard (San Diego State) & Andrew Bogut (Utah). Also the son of former NFL defensive end Simeon Rice.
